So elegant, so lovely… the NEW Gwyneth Flourish die. Cuts and embosses like a dream…beautiful swirls…so classy! So much to love with this release!
I also used the Pine from the NEW Pinecone Corner die, the 25 ornament from the NEW Advent Calendar Set and the NEW Merry Christmas Flourish stamp, all from this new release!
Combined with the beautiful Poppystamps Poinsettia die, the Virtuoso Music die and the Cherise Label die. (isn’t it cool how the ornament dangles from the label?!) I used Memory Box Thistle, Juniper, Graphite and Raspberry card-stock and Thistle Moroccan card-stock.
